绿色圃中小学教育网

rand函数的使用方法

[原创]
导读 rand函数是一种在C语言中常用的随机数生成函数。可以使用r。绿色圃中小学教育网百科专栏,提供全方位全领域的生活知识

rand函数是一种在C语言中常用的随机数生成函数。可以使用rand函数来生成一系列伪随机数,范围在0到RAND_MAX之间。

rand函数的使用方法如下:

1. 导入头文件stdlib.h。

2. 调用srand函数来设置随机数生成器的初始值。可以用time函数来获取当前时间作为初始值,也可以自己设置一个固定值。

3. 调用rand函数来生成随机数。

示例代码如下:

```

#include

#include

#include

int main() {

srand(time(NULL)); // 设置随机数生成器的初始值

for (int i = 0; i < 10; i++) {

printf('%d ', rand()); // 生成随机数并输出

}

return 0;

}

```

上述代码中,srand函数使用了time函数来获取当前时间作为初始值,然后使用for循环调用rand函数生成10个随机数,并通过printf函数输出。

需要注意的是,rand函数生成的随机数是伪随机数,不是真正的随机数。因此,如果需要高质量的随机数,建议使用其他更加复杂的随机数生成算法。